Dear all, I just graduated from akpk this January and I do follow your suggestion to apply credit card from bank which I do not deal with them and I got my credit card last week! Another suggestion for those who wan to settle it earlier have to call the bank collection department and negotiate for the amount you are going to pay, u can save few thousand depends on how much u owe the bank! QUOTE(MNet @ Apr 23 2014, 05:47 PM)
how much fee u pay to akpk?
*
I transferred credit card outstanding balance to akpk RM65K, 6banks with average RM10K, when I want to settle it one time off, I request from bank and each bank give me discount about RM800, that's y I said save few thousand. Have to call each bank to negotiate!

QUOTE(purplehill @ Jun 3 2014, 10:17 AM)
Hi i wanted to settle AKPK and refinance my property.  How long does it take you to get the housing loan approved after your name is clear from the system?  i seriously want to know how soon can i get the loan approved by the bank after i have settled the AKPK.
*
I not sure on the refinance of housing loan, but first thing u have to do now is to get the money u owe to bank under akpk settle, ur name can b removed from their system after 2weeks. I just graduated from akpk program in Feb, I check the ccris report in march and it is all clear...then I started apply credit card in April and I got it in mid april...I will say,don't worry on how long u get the loan approve from the bank cox this is not under your control, what u have to do now it really get this akpk settle,pay off everything n get release letter....when your ccriss report is clear,then only u talk to the bank for housing loan or whatever,hope it can help

QUOTE(purplehill @ Jun 3 2014, 11:24 AM)
I heard some said that do not apply loan or credit card from the same bank that previously under AKPK program.  Did you get the credit card from the same bank that previously under AKPK?  I'm worried that the application not approved by the same bank.
*
No. I got the credit card from other bank which I not deal with them under the akpk program, I got many info in this forum saying better don't apply the previous bank which we owe them money and at the end go thru akpk. So, I think u can try to apply from other bank, chances is higher..I'm the successful example,the bank offer me platinum card from UOB (overseas bank).
